2021 ECE Day: Seminars and Student Research Competition

The Department of Electrical and Computer Engineering at Illinois Institute of Technology held its annual ECE Day event. It hosted research panels, a research seminar, a student research competition, and the ECE faculty met with the ECE Board of Advisors to discuss department updates and strategic planning.
Earlier in the week, 70 students competed in various research presentation categories over two days. They were judged by a panel of ECE faculty and members of the ECE Board of Advisors, and there were a total of 30 student finalists.
âThe day was a huge success,â says Jafar Saniie, chair of the ECE department and Walter and Harriet Filmer Endowed Chair in Electrical and Computer Engineering. âThe projects were all so impressive, and we are very proud of all the studentsâ hard work and efforts. We look forward to seeing what research next yearâs competition will bring.â
Following faculty-led research panels, the event ended with a research seminar presented to more than 90 attendees by Harris Perlstein Professor of Electrical and Computer Engineering Yongyi Yang, a recent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ers fellow, entitled âSignal and Image Processing in Tomographic ImagingâA Tutorialâ and an award ceremony announcing the winners of the student competition.
